Grannet is a city in Dragon Quest Heroes: The World Tree's Woe and the Blight Below. It is the stronghold of the dwarves and is located on an island with mountainous terrain in the northeast part of the world. Its name is a homonym with the word "granite".

Dragon Quest Heroes: The World Tree's Woe and the Blight Below[edit | edit source]
Grannet is the fourth major location visited in the story, after visiting Sylvea. The party, now accompanied by Jessica and Yangus, decide to visit there to see if it is under attack from monsters like other places in the world. There at the tunnel that leads to the dwarven settlement, they encounter a horde of monsters led by groups of Mawkeepers and defeat them. They press on and discover another one of the World Tree's roots, which the monsters must be after. Another group of monsters advances, forcing the heroes to fight once again to keep the Yggdrasil root safe. The monsters are driven away from the root, but the dwarves are still nowhere to be seen. Further inside the depths of the caverns, the heroes encounter a young dwarven woman being protected from a group of monsters by two other young women—Bianca and Nera. The heroes decide to step in to prevent them from being overwhelmed by their numbers, introducing themselves after the battle. The young dwarven woman is Beryl, the Foreman's daughter, and the other two hail from a place called Mostroferrato, which no one else recognises. The group deduces then that the two young women are visitors from another world, as well.
The band of adventurers explain the current situation to Bianca and Nera, who decide to help out in order to reunite Beryl with her betrothed and her father, the Foreman. Bianca jokingly teases that it's sweet watching Luceus and Aurora bicker as they plan the next move. Aurora becomes flustered and insists that they're just friends who've known each other for a long time. With their newfound allies, the group sallies forth to locate the Foreman and Beryl's fiancé while driving back more monsters. During the fighting, Beryl asks Bianca and Nera why they've decided to help her. Nera explains that the two of them are expected to be married soon, causing Bianca to become bashful. The heroes manage to beat back the group of monsters, but still can't find the dwarven duo. Beryl offers to serve as a guide in the caverns while searching for them. They eventually make their way to the Sanctum at the very heart of Grannet, where the Foreman and Beryl's betrothed are about to be attacked by a Stone guardian. After a fierce battle, Beryl is reunited with her father and her fiancé. Both Bianca and Nera will then join the party.
